尿酸代谢过程中相关酶及转运体的研究进展 被引量:5

Development on related enzyme and transporters in uric acid melabolism

摘要 尿酸代谢过程中黄嘌呤氧化酶(XOD)、磷酸核糖焦磷酸合成酶(PRS)等关键酶遗传缺陷和尿酸盐转运体人尿酸盐阴离子转运体1(hURATE1)、人尿酸盐转运体(hUATE)、人有机阴离子转运体(hOAT)、尿调节素、多药耐药相关蛋白4(MRP4)等转运体的基因突变可导致尿酸代谢稳态失衡,引发高尿酸血症和(或)痛风。本研究就尿酸合成和排泄途径中相关酶及转运体的研究现状进行综述,为诊治痛风和高尿酸血症及特异性靶点药物研发提供新思路和新方向。
